Find Your AA Booking: American Airlines Reference Guide

This alphanumeric code, generated upon reservation confirmation, serves as a digital key to passenger flight details within the airline’s system. Consisting of six characters, it allows individuals to access itinerary information, manage bookings, and facilitate check-in procedures. For example, a sequence such as “ABC12D” could represent a confirmed reservation on a particular American Airlines flight.

Its importance stems from its function as a centralized identifier, ensuring efficient retrieval of travel arrangements. This identifier streamlines various processes, from online check-in to requesting seat changes, and assists airline personnel in locating and modifying reservation information when required. Historically, such codes replaced manual record-keeping systems, drastically improving accuracy and speed in managing passenger data.

Buy Southwest Drink Tickets? + Tips & Tricks

These are physical vouchers previously distributed by a particular air carrier, entitling the holder to a complimentary alcoholic beverage during a flight. For instance, a passenger might receive one of these upon experiencing a significant delay or as a gesture of goodwill from a flight attendant.

These provided a tangible benefit to travelers, enhancing the onboard experience and representing a form of compensation for inconveniences. Historically, they were a common tool used by airlines to improve customer satisfaction and foster positive relationships with their passengers.

AA Retiree Travel: Your Guide & News

Eligibility for reduced-rate or complimentary flight benefits is a significant component of the compensation and benefits package offered to individuals upon their retirement from the aforementioned air carrier. These privileges typically extend to immediate family members and registered companions, affording opportunities for personal leisure and travel at considerably lower costs than standard commercial fares.

The provision of these post-employment flight privileges is often viewed as a powerful incentive for long-term employee retention and a valuable recognition of years of service dedicated to the organization. Historically, this benefit served as a means to foster employee loyalty and create a sense of ongoing connection with the airline following retirement. The specific parameters of such programs, including eligibility requirements, fare structures, and booking procedures, are subject to change and are typically outlined in official company policy documents.
